Hampton Trace has the feel of an established Columbia neighborhood with a strong sense of place. Homes sit on established lots with mature landscaping, covered porches, and plenty of character at the curb. The setting is especially appealing if you like a neighborhood that feels tucked in, yet still connected to the city’s everyday conveniences.

Most homes here are single-family residences built between 1979 and 1988, and the neighborhood leans into traditional Southern styling. You’ll see Charleston-inspired façades, Cape Cod forms, raised cottages, and brick exteriors in the mix. Many homes feature hardwood floors, fireplaces, formal dining rooms, eat-in kitchens, and flexible main-level spaces that work well for offices, studios, or extra sitting rooms. Outdoor living is a real theme, with screened porches, wraparound porches, decks, patios, fenced yards, and in some cases pools and pool houses. Basements are common in the available records, while garages appear less frequently, which gives the community a more porch-and-driveway character than a garage-centered one.
Daily life in Hampton Trace tends to revolve around the home itself. Backyards are often set up for lingering, with mature trees, storage sheds, workshop space, and room for entertaining. Some properties add a heated pool, while others highlight covered porches, fire pits, and wooded backdrops that soften the neighborhood feel. The rhythm here is relaxed but practical: updated interiors, renovated kitchens and baths, and recent mechanical improvements show that many owners have invested in keeping these homes comfortable and current.

Hampton Trace sits in southeast Columbia near Garners Ferry Road, with easy access to I-77 and quick connections toward downtown Columbia. Listings also point to Fort Jackson, the Devine District, the VA Hospital, and MUSC Medical School as nearby destinations, along with Target and local dining options. One property notes a short drive to downtown and Fort Jackson, while another places the neighborhood less than 15 minutes from downtown Columbia and about 5 minutes from Fort Jackson, the VA Hospital, and MUSC Medical School. School assignments commonly associated with the neighborhood are Meadowfield Elementary, Hand Middle, and Dreher High, placing the community within a familiar Columbia school pattern.
